How wifi cameras connect and store footage
WiFi cameras connect to your home network using standard wireless protocols and typically support 2.4 GHz, with some models offering 5 GHz or compatibility with mesh networks. They stream live video to your phone or computer and can save footage locally on microSD cards, network attached storage, or in the cloud. Cloud storage is common but often comes with ongoing costs, while local options keep data within your home. Encryption is crucial during transmission, so verify that the camera uses HTTPS or end-to-end encryption for data in transit. Storage choices influence latency, access, and privacy. You may set motion-triggered recording, continuous recording, or a hybrid approach depending on bandwidth and storage limits. Essential features to compare
When evaluating wifi cameras for security, prioritize resolution and frame rate, a broad field of view, and dependable night vision. Look for smart detection (people, vehicles, pets) to reduce false alerts and ensure you can customize zones. Two-way audio is useful for door intercoms or talking to family members. Storage options should be clear, with a choice between local (microSD or NAS) and cloud solutions with transparent privacy terms. Encryption and regular firmware updates are non negotiable for security. If you plan to place cameras outdoors, check weatherproofing and IP ratings. Power options matter too; plug-in models are stable but less flexible, while battery-powered units offer placement freedom but require charging. Compatibility with home ecosystems like Amazon Alexa or Google Home can simplify automation. Map your installation spots, estimate bandwidth needs, and pick models that balance features and cost. Setup and network planning for reliability
Begin with a clean network plan before installing cameras. Ensure adequate bandwidth is available for all cameras and streaming quality. Place cameras within reliable range of the router, ideally 15–30 feet unobstructed for 2.4 GHz or closer for 5 GHz. If your home has dead spots, consider mesh WiFi, range extenders, or a dedicated network for cameras to reduce interference. Use strong, unique passwords for your WiFi and camera accounts, and enable two-factor authentication where possible. Update firmware on both the router and cameras regularly to patch vulnerabilities. Consider the network topology you want: direct camera-to-cloud, local storage with periodic cloud backups, or hybrid setups. Ensure that you configure secure remote access and disable unnecessary ports or services. Placement strategies and real world scenarios
Placement dramatically affects effectiveness. Front door cameras deter porch pirates, while driveway or sidewalk cameras monitor vehicle activity. Interior cameras in living rooms or nurseries require less rugged hardware but higher optical quality. Avoid placing cameras where sunlight can glare or where they might be blocked by furniture. Ensure a clean line of sight to entry points while keeping cables tidy if you use wired power options. In outdoor environments, mount cameras at elevated heights to minimize tampering and angle them to cover critical zones. Lighting conditions vary; consider cameras with infrared or low-light performance for nighttime coverage. For apartment dwellers, consider compact, indoor devices that use magnetic mounts or suction cups for quick relocation. Troubleshooting common issues
If a camera cannot connect, verify the network SSID, password, and that the camera is not blocked by firewalls. Check that the router is broadcasting on a supported frequency and that there are no IP conflicts on the network. If footage looks choppy, investigate bandwidth usage, switch to a wired backhaul if possible, or reduce video resolution and frame rate for stable streaming. Battery-powered models may experience rapid drain during cold weather or high activity; keep spares charged and monitor battery health. For cloud-only cameras, ensure the service is not experiencing outages and review your subscription status. Finally, if you encounter frequent false alerts, recalibrate motion zones and update detection algorithms if the firmware provides such controls. Is cloud storage safer than local storage for wifi cameras?
Cloud storage provides off-site backups and convenient access but relies on the service provider’s security. Local storage keeps footage within your home and can be more private, but it may be vulnerable if physical storage is stolen. A hybrid approach can offer balance.
